Recommendation Scoring
# Scoring weights (configurable)
WEIGHTS = {
"fundamental": 0.35,
"technical": 0.30,
"sentiment": 0.20,
"momentum": 0.15,
}
def calculate_recommendation(scores: dict) -> tuple[str, float]:
"""
Calculate final recommendation from component scores.
Returns: (recommendation, confidence)
"""
weighted_score = sum(
scores[k] * WEIGHTS[k]
for k in WEIGHTS
)
if weighted_score >= 7.0:
return ("STRONG BUY", min(weighted_score / 10, 0.95))
elif weighted_score >= 5.5:
return ("BUY", weighted_score / 10)
elif weighted_score >= 4.5:
return ("HOLD", 0.5)
elif weighted_score >= 3.0:
return ("SELL", (10 - weighted_score) / 10)
else:
return ("STRONG SELL", min((10 - weighted_score) / 10, 0.95))
Key Metrics Reference
Fundamental Metrics
| Metric |
Good |
Neutral |
Poor |
| P/E Ratio |
< 15 |
15-25 |
> 25 |
| P/B Ratio |
< 1.5 |
1.5-3 |
> 3 |
| Debt/Equity |
< 0.5 |
0.5-1.5 |
> 1.5 |
| Current Ratio |
> 2 |
1-2 |
< 1 |
| ROE |
> 15% |
10-15% |
< 10% |
| Piotroski F |
7-9 |
4-6 |
0-3 |
Technical Signals
| Indicator |
Bullish |
Bearish |
| Price vs SMA200 |
Above |
Below |
| MACD |
Positive crossover |
Negative crossover |
| RSI |
< 30 (oversold) |
> 70 (overbought) |
| Volume |
Increasing on up days |
Increasing on down days |
